|
|
@101:93aa745d57ff
|
7 years |
drnlmuller |
draw protagnist bounding box in debug mode. Redo drawing logic to …
|
|
|
@100:96bdfadeb461
|
7 years |
firxen |
Cleaner direction key management.
|
|
|
@98:93256a0987a2
|
7 years |
drnlmuller |
Fix newer pep8 continuation complaint
|
|
|
@97:c177cdc41477
|
7 years |
firxen |
Add WASD controls, switch to "c" for form change.
|
|
|
@95:ecba9550ad8d
|
7 years |
drnlmuller |
Fill the exterior with the blackness of space
|
|
|
@94:9ef5c5810dcd
|
7 years |
firxen |
Comment out shape drawing for protagonist. Useful for debugging, but …
|
|
|
@93:d6a49f0c1e6e
|
7 years |
firxen |
Rectangular human protagonist shape, refactored physicsers.
|
|
|
@92:4c7e85906453
|
7 years |
firxen |
Start next to the wall, not in it.
|
|
|
@91:5c31b4d1851c
|
7 years |
firxen |
Remove NullPhysicser?, since it looks like everything needs PHYSICS!!!
|
|
|
@90:a8d83de5b460
|
7 years |
stefano |
Dump our YAML subset too
|
|
|
@89:102043902451
|
7 years |
stefano |
Simple (subset of) YAML parser
|
|
|
@87:75d8ad4bf9b5
|
7 years |
drnlmuller |
Hack in viewport
|
|
|
@86:a5c839994d41
|
7 years |
drnlmuller |
Tweak render order
|
|
|
@85:c56eeaabd850
|
7 years |
drnlmuller |
Make the window resizable
|
|
|
@84:ef8e799477e0
|
7 years |
drnlmuller |
Point pymunk at a screen surface, not the display to make things saner
|
|
|
@83:d7beca6b6762
|
7 years |
davidsharpe |
Fix whitespace again.
|
|
|
@82:11b0017b5e4b
|
7 years |
davidsharpe |
Fix whitespace.
|
|
|
@81:a1b4d09e6f23
|
7 years |
davidsharpe |
Floor switch with horrible hackery.
|
|
|
@76:29ace74cc9de
|
7 years |
stefano |
Human
|
|
|
@75:79748a884eb5
|
7 years |
stefano |
Put levels in a levels directory
|
|
|
@73:e118458a4e9c
|
7 years |
davidsharpe |
Added environmental motion effects to protagonist.
|
|
|
@72:5db052531510
|
7 years |
stefano |
Move save() to Level
|
|
|
@66:8bf0459ebc56
|
7 years |
firxen |
Clean up a few things.
|
|
|
@65:a99ac95a2940
|
7 years |
firxen |
Move protagonist object to the right place.
|
|
|
@64:972142c543ef
|
7 years |
firxen |
Unused import.
|
|
|
@63:7f038ee778ad
|
7 years |
firxen |
Put werewolf facing direction magic back.
|
|
|
@62:1d67a8c9861d
|
7 years |
firxen |
WTF whitespace?!?!?!?!
|
|
|
@61:a0399535bb7c
|
7 years |
firxen |
Fix import.
|
|
|
@60:34a87ec12124
|
7 years |
firxen |
Fix long line.
|
|
|
@59:b412704a6737
|
7 years |
firxen |
Start of game object stuff.
|
|
|
@58:cee0b845dedc
|
7 years |
stefano |
Centre the wolf on its body
|
|
|
@56:b9430b4a48da
|
7 years |
stefano |
Now with a werewolf
|
|
|
@54:2c1b85b6f457
|
7 years |
hodgestar |
Add .get_file() to resources.
|
|
|
@53:39d346467052
|
7 years |
hodgestar |
Draw all the walls.
|
|
|
@52:b55f1783eb6e
|
7 years |
hodgestar |
Tweak wall thickness and human impulse.
|
|
|
@50:94d47bfcc7bb
|
7 years |
drnlmuller |
Approximate levels and walls
|
|
|
@47:82036437ebf6
|
7 years |
hodgestar |
Better movement and swap between werewolf and human form with 'w' …
|
|
|
@41:1d087f79ca29
|
7 years |
hodgestar |
Use fixed timestemp because pymunk docs say this is an order of …
|
|
|
@39:0e7bb6eb7c0a
|
7 years |
stefano |
Don't prefix the basedir twice
|
|
|
@37:4140780c21bc
|
7 years |
hodgestar |
Give screens a name and a world.
|
|
|
@35:457280af5f3a
|
7 years |
hodgestar |
Remove unused import.
|
|
|
@34:2995723e8ccf
|
7 years |
hodgestar |
Move and hold.
|
|
|
@33:d9b65cf72db4
|
7 years |
stefano |
Prettier resource loading module
|
|
|
@32:0e49648f8d74
|
7 years |
firxen |
Arbitrary function condition.
|
|
|
@31:c62ed518e5c8
|
7 years |
hodgestar |
Fix repor and add type-check to eq.
|
|
|
@29:58505d3482b6
|
7 years |
stefano |
Text on the menu screen
|
|
|
@28:c03982fe3c70
|
7 years |
firxen |
Protagonist and environment.
|
|
|
@27:3e4d8091268c
|
7 years |
hodgestar |
A werewolf always knows where she's going.
|
|
|
@25:e93eac7cf8c2
|
7 years |
hodgestar |
Consider a spherical werewolf.
|
|
|
@24:50babb330261
|
7 years |
stefano |
Forgot to add mutators…
|
|
|
@21:1b048d2a8411
|
7 years |
hodgestar |
Fake area.
|
|
|
@20:347667c941de
|
7 years |
hodgestar |
Hook up area.
|
|
|
@19:113f31bd9d49
|
7 years |
hodgestar |
Clean-up imports.
|
|
|
@18:9ecb1d222ee0
|
7 years |
hodgestar |
Screens.
|
|
|
@17:b0644173d0aa
|
7 years |
stefano |
Image loading
|
|
|
@16:fe1426d09074
|
7 years |
hodgestar |
Merge.
|
|
|
@15:980339c28b42
|
7 years |
hodgestar |
Add start of engine / event dispatcher.
|
|
|
@14:17b233a54651
|
7 years |
stefano |
Docstring
|
|
|
@13:b410c7153d52
|
7 years |
stefano |
Option parsing
|
|
|
@11:1cd05cfec375
|
7 years |
hodgestar |
Add start of screen / level / area object.
|
|
|
@10:f7a0d6fd9f00
|
7 years |
stefano |
Some startup code
|
|
|
@8:3769f9d260d8
|
7 years |
drnlmuller |
Add traditional / splite to filepath
|
|
|
@0:1ea8fa09b70f
|
7 years |
drnlmuller |
Add skellington
|